HOW MUCH MONEY IS INVOLVED IN THE SPORTS BETTING INDUSTRY?

The sports betting industry is a multi-billion-dollar industry that generates significant revenue globally. The exact figures can vary based on factors such as geographic location, regulatory environment, popular sports, and technological advancements. Global Revenue:

The global sports betting industry was estimated to be worth over $85 billion annually.

United States:

The legalization of sports betting in various U.S. states has led to a significant increase in revenue. In 2020, the legal sports betting handle (total amount wagered) in the U.S. was over $21 billion.

Europe:

Europe has a well-established sports betting market. The United Kingdom, for example, has a highly active betting industry, with billions of pounds being wagered annually.

Asia:

Asia, particularly countries like China, Japan, and South Korea, also contributes significantly to the global sports betting market.
Online Betting:

Online and mobile betting platforms have contributed to the growth of the industry, allowing people to place bets conveniently from their devices.

Major Sporting Events:

Major sporting events like the FIFA World Cup, UEFA European Championship, and the Olympic Games attract billions of dollars in betting activity.

Technological Advancements:

The integration of technology, including mobile apps, live betting platforms, and data analytics, has further boosted the industry’s growth.

Regulation and Legalization:

The regulation and legalization of sports betting in more jurisdictions have expanded the industry’s reach and revenue potential.
